On Thursday Studio-808 had its first ever Accessory Style Lounge and it was a huge success! The event was part of this year’s Fashion Focus week and took place at the Hard Rock Hotel. This could not have been a more ideal location for this event. The event was also sponsored by Vitamin Water, Factio Magazine, and figmediainc.com.
The event featured Susan Elizabeth Designs, jules, Love, LuLu Mae, Squasht, and Lisa Spagnolo. These Chicago designers brought a wide array of accessories including bags, jewerly, hats, ties, and hair pieces. There was a little something for everyone.

jules for Bright Pink
Local jewlery designer, Jules Schwanbeck, has designed customizable 14k “pink” gold ID tags in honor of breast cancer awareness month. A precendage of the proceeds will go to Bright Pink.
The ID Tags are customized to wear those closest to your heart – a parent, spouse or partner’s initial on the rectangle, the wearer’s initial or children’s initials on the circles or simply a first initial on a circle and last initial on a rectangle.
jules. ID Tags are hand–crafted, heirloom quality and available in 14k pink gold, 14k white gold, 14k yellow
gold, oxidized and sterling silver. Tags are available for women and men in rectangle and two different size
circle shapes, suspended from a beautiful caviar faceted women’s chain or men’s ball chain.

Fall accessory trends from the Chicago Collection
It’s official – Fall has arrived. Now if getting our fall look in order was just as easy as packing away those summer sandals we’d be set! Well, good news we’ve done some of the work for you…check out the Chicago collection for our fall accessory trends to rock.

Chicago Collection - Fall '09 Issue

Chicago Collection - Fall Trends
Trend #1: Skinny Belts – While we’ve been enamored by the wide belt for the past few seasons, it’s the smaller sibling that has fashionistas a flutter this fall. Throw it around everything from a monotone shift to a white blouse.
Trend #2: Rosettes – These perfectly preppy but classic accessories are showing up everywhere from hair clips to shoes and can add a fun twist to that classic fall dress. Check out Chicago designer Borris Powell to see how he takes this trend to the next level.
Trend #3: Ankle boots. A fall essential these edgy boots can be found in everything from suede to patent leather to animal print. They are hot right now! pairing them with a high-waisted skirt is going to be the fall look to rock!
Trend #4: Statement gem necklaces. Always the attention getter, throwing on this essential jewelry piece is the fastest way to add personality to any outfit. Check out unique statement neckwear from Chicago designer Jules. (www.studio-808.com)

Studio-808, Inc. is the brainchild of Erin Creaney, a PR executive with a near-athletic enthusiasm for emerging designers. Finding herself searching the city for great designers with new and different looks, she knew a larger operation was in order. What's more, she felt the world needed to know about the fashion percolating in the Windy City. Thus was born Studio-808.com.
